Pre-Installation Checks and Preparation
Inspect the bathtub for any damages. If damage is found, contact your retailer.
Carefully remove the tub from its crate/box. Important Note: The bathtub must be carried by a minimum of 2 adults, upside down only. Do not carry the bathtub by its panel.
To avoid scratches or damages, place the tub on cardboard with a soft blanket on top of the cardboard.
Set your bathtub on two 4x4 pieces of lumber to gain access from the bottom. Place a tray beneath the bathtub.
Very Important! Before proceeding with installation, ensure the push scupper plug, drain, and integrated overflow are properly sealed and tightened.
Test for leaks: Push the scupper plug to a closed position and fill the bathtub with cold water above the overflow level. Check for overflow leakage and drain leakage. Check for any leaks around the drain and pipe. (NOTE: Due to surface tension, it is normal for a small amount of water to pool around the drain).
If a leakage occurs, disassemble the drain line or overflow assemblies and apply plumbing putty/silicone caulk to fix the leakage. Once the leakage test is performed, proceed to installation.
Installation with Underfloor Access
Step 1: Prepare Floor
Clean, level, and prepare the floor for installation. Place the tub in the exact installed location on the floor. Trace the outline of the bathtub with a pencil and mark the drain hole location on the floor. Move the tub away so plumbing can be installed.
Step 2: Position Tub Upside Down
Turn the bathtub upside down and set it on a non-abrasive mat, blanket, or cardboard to prevent any scratches on the tub rim.
Step 3: Level Tub Feet
Place a level across the bottom of the tub and adjust the tub feet levelers to touch the level. Then, raise the levelers an additional 1/8" or 3/16" so that the weight of the tub, water, and user are fully supported by the feet adjusters and not the tub walls.
Step 4: Install Tail Piece
Install a 1-1/2" tail piece along with the corresponding flanged washer and 1-1/2" nut to the drain body.
Step 5: Connect Drain Assembly
Measure and cut the tail piece to the appropriate length to reach the trap adapter. When setting the tub drain, insert the tail piece with a 1-1/2" slip joint and rubber washer into the trap adapter and tighten properly.
Step 6: Apply Sealant
Apply a generous bead of adhesive or waterproof silicone to the bottom of the tub and a bead of tub and tile caulk around the edge of the tub.
Step 7: Position and Connect
Flip the tub over and carefully set the tub into position with the tail piece assembly to the P-trap and connect to the drain.
Step 8: Leak Test
Fill the tub with water to the overflow and then drain the tub while inspecting the waste and overflow connection below the floor for any leaks. Access from below will be necessary for this step.
Step 9: Clean Excess Sealant
With the tub now set in place, wipe off any excess tub or tile caulking/adhesive where the tub meets the floor with a wet cloth.
Step 10: Allow Silicone to Dry
DO NOT SHOWER or MOVE the tub after installation, as it will take about 24 hours for the silicone sealant to dry.
Installation on Slab Floor (No Underfloor Access)
Step 1: Prepare Floor
Clean, level, and prepare the floor for installation. Place the tub in the exact installed location on the floor. Trace the outline of the bathtub with a pencil and mark the drain hole location on the floor. Move the tub away so plumbing can be installed.
Step 2: Position Tub Upside Down
Turn the bathtub upside down and set it on a non-abrasive mat, blanket, or cardboard to prevent any scratches on the tub rim.
Step 3: Level Tub Feet
Place a level across the bottom of the tub and adjust the tub feet levelers to touch the level. Then, raise the levelers an additional 1/8" or 3/16" so that the weight of the tub, water, and user are fully supported by the feet adjusters and not the tub walls.
Step 4: Measure Drain Pipe
Measure the actual distance from the drain into the drain pipe on the floor. The drain pipe should extend approximately 1" above the finish floor. Use a drain adapter (not provided) if necessary.
Step 5: Prepare Drain Pipe
Clean the surrounding of the drain pipe with a cloth in preparation for setting the drain. The area should be dry and free of any debris. Apply a bead of clear silicone or plumber putty around the drain body and pass it through the drain hole. Also, apply plumber putty to the washer and slide it over the bottom of the drain body.
Step 6: Apply Putty to Gasket
Apply putty to fix the rubber slip gasket over the drain vent.
Step 7: Apply Sealant
Apply a generous bead of adhesive or waterproof silicone to the bottom of the tub and caulk around the edge of the tub.
Step 8: Position and Connect
Flip the tub over and carefully set the tub into position with the tail piece assembly to the waste vent and connect to the drain.
Step 9: Clean Excess Sealant
With the tub now set in place, wipe off any excess tub or tile caulking/adhesive where the tub meets the floor with a wet cloth.
Step 10: Allow Silicone to Dry
DO NOT SHOWER or MOVE the tub after installation, as it will take about 24 hours for the silicone sealant to dry.
Important Safety Rules
❗ ATTENTION! ALWAYS FOLLOW THESE PRECAUTIONS WHEN USING A BATHTUB
- Warning: The bathtub must be installed and used as described in this manual.
- Warning: Use caution when entering or exiting the bathtub.
- Warning: Do not permit children or persons with infirmities to use the bathtub without supervision of an adult.
- Warning: People using any medications or having adverse medical history must consult a physician prior to use of the bathtub to avoid potential hyperthermia and possible drowning.
- Warning: Water temperature over 100°F (38°C) may cause hyperthermia and/or other health problems. Check water temperature and adjust it for your personal comfort.
- Warning: Never use the bathtub while intoxicated, after taking meals, or consuming any alcoholic beverages. Consuming alcoholic beverages before or during bathing can cause drowsiness and may result in hyperthermia, loss of consciousness, or even drowning.
- Warning: If you are pregnant or suspect you may be pregnant, consult your doctor before using the bathtub.
- Warning: Never use any electrical devices such as hair dryers, lamps, telephones, TVs, radios, or others within 5 feet of the bathtub.
- Warning: Do not overfill the bathtub before entering. Entering a filled bathtub can cause overflow and slippery conditions. Use extreme caution when entering and exiting.
Care and Cleaning
- Most dirt will wash off with mild soap and warm water.
- For tough spots, use liquid dishwashing soap or non-chlorine bleach.
- Do not use abrasive materials such as steel wool or scouring pads on the acrylic surface.
- Always test cleaning solutions on a small area before using on the entire surface.
- Do not allow cleaning solutions to soak on the acrylic surface.
- Rinse thoroughly with water immediately and wipe dry with a soft cloth.
Repair and Maintenance
- Use liquid polish compound, such as Gel-Gloss Kitchen and Bath Polish(TM), to maintain the original shine of the acrylic surface.
- Light scratches can be removed with polishing compound for automobiles.
- For deeper scratches, use wet sandpaper (1500 grit or higher). Always add water when sanding and lightly sand the area larger than the scratch in a circular motion. Repeat until the scratch is removed. Use a soft cloth and a small amount of polishing compound to restore shine. Repeat as needed until surface shine is restored.
IMPORTANT!
- DO NOT USE: Abrasive cleaners such as acid, ammonia, bleach, and similar solutions. These may cause corrosion, finish peeling, or dull the surface.
- DO NOT USE: Abrasive sponges or cloth. Never use steel wool or wire brushes, as they will permanently scratch the surface.
